You can be the first responder here and think you had a lock on the item, but the seller has also listed it on eBay, Craig's List, SSW, newspaper and six other sites, and you may not be the first. So to be fair, the seller has to check the time of the PM or email, and then somebody is disappointed (at best or po'd at worst). It's happened to me, and it didn't seem like a good way to do biz.

I'd say to list an item or bunch of items on one site, and if you don't get a sale, remove the ad and list it on one of the other sites. If you still don't get a sale, remove the ad and try another, etc.
